If I could give this business negative stars I WOULD!!!! They are the biggest scam artists I've ever worked with. I took my Bravo out drives to them to be tuned up and was quoted $2,200. Then a week later I get a call from "Little Bill" saying the gears and shafts need to be replaced and was quoted $7,700. I told him to do the work and he charged me. Because I had new motors put in my boat (thank god it wasn't by Victory Marine), I had to change out the gears in the out-drives. Upon taking apart the out-drives the mechanic from Gulf Coast Marine Services in Kemah found that Victory Marine HAD NOT done anything to the out-drives. The gears and shafts looked like they were the original ones that had over 300 hours on them. The only thing Victory Marine did was paint the outside of the out-drives to make it look all nice and new and charge me $7.783.18!!!!! My suggestion to whomever is fortunate enough to read this is to run as far away from Victory Marine as possible. Gulf Coast Marine Services is much more professional.

I took my dad's old boat, a 1992 Wellcraft Eclipse, worth about $3,500, to Victory Marine in March of 2013. The out-drive stopped raising and lowering at the end of last summer, and I wanted to get the boat ready to use this summer. Due to limited funds and a low-value boat I asked for an estimate before I authorized the work. The boat was supposed to be repaired for $475, but after paying and taking the boat, the outdrive still failed to lower when I tested it out.



I took the boat back to the shop and even though business had picked up they assured me re-repairs take priority. After 2 weeks I called to see if the work was complete and it was not, but they said they'd work on it and hopefully have it done in the next few days. When I went in to pick up the boat they presented me with a new invoice for $1,502, for parts and work that I never authorized. Needless to say, this was unexpected and far more than I ever intended to spend on a boat of such low value. Since then, my boat has been at Victory Marine and they have refused every attempt for me to negotiate.



I filed a complaint with the BBB, offering $525 for the additional repairs done, a total of $1,000, to Victory Marine simply to have my out-drive go up and down, but they responded extremely unprofessionally and later failed to respond, leaving the complaint with the BBB as "unresolved".



At this point my only option appears to be small claims court, another expense which may take the remainder of the summer to resolve. I have never dealt with a less professional group of people or been treated with such disrespect by a business. Do yourself a favor, don't do business here, or if you have to, get a lawyer first.

I took my Donzi with twin 525s for Preventive Maintenance at Victory Marine. Interestingly I found out They do not know what a “Used Valve” looks like & put a Used Set of Heads on one engine. This led to a complete tear down at Nickens Brothers where a Crack in one of the Victory heads was discovered along with a bad cam shaft. Victory did pay for the rework of the heads, but to add insult to injury, I was charged full list price plus for the cam shaft. What Really concerns me is the engines had 350 hours on them & with the installation of the bad heads by Victory, it probably would have been a catastrophic engine failure (of which would not have been their fault of course). The other issue I had was Victory rebuilt an XR drive & it lasted about ten (10) hours – Lost a complete upper & again was Not Their Problem. Nice folks, but be careful as to the work Victory claims to do.
